If salt (5.99 × 10–6 mol) is dissolved in 1.50 × 10–2 l of water, which expression can be used to find the molarity of the resul
kolezko [41]

The molarity of the resulting solution is 3.99 × 10⁻⁴ M. The correct option is the third option 3.99 × 10⁻⁴ M

<h3>Molarity of a solution</h3>

From the question, we are to determine the molarity of the resulting solution

From the given information,

Number of moles = 5.99 × 10⁻⁶ mol

Volume = 1.50 × 10⁻² L

Using the formula,

Molarity = Number moles / Volume

∴ Molarity = (5.99 × 10⁻⁶) / (1.50 × 10⁻²)
Molarity = 3.99 × 10⁻⁴ M

Hence, the molarity of the resulting solution is 3.99 × 10⁻⁴ M. The correct option is the third option 3.99 × 10⁻⁴ M

Larry makes sandwiches for lunch everyday. He can make 6 sandwiches with every 3 tomatoes he buys. If he bought 6 tomatoes, how
malfutka [58]

Answer:

12 sandwiches

Step-by-step explanation:

Make a proportion

He can make 6 sandwiches with 3 tomatoes, and x sandwiches with 6 tomatoes

6/3=x/6

Multiply both sides by 6 to isolate the variable, x

6*6/3=x/6*6

12=x

So, with 6 tomatoes, he can make 12 sandwiches
